Scottish Cot Death Trust

Supporting bereaved parents; funding research and raising awareness

The Scottish Cot Death Trust has been in existence in Scotland for over 21 years and during that time has made a significant difference in the field of Cot Death. However, with 1 baby dying from cot death every 12 days in Scotland our work is far from over.

The Scottish Cot Death Trust is the only Scottish charity raising awareness of Cot Death; supporting people coping with the sudden and unexplained death of a previously healthy baby and funding research into the possible causes of Cot Death.

Our Services include:
. Early bereavement support
. Home-Visiting for bereaved families
. Befriending - to enable bereaved parents to support other bereaved parents
. Breathing Monitor Loan Service - to provide peace of mind when a new baby arrives
. Educational talks aimed at health professionals and parents/carers of babies
. Research program to identify potential causative factors

We receive less than 3% of our annual income from Government sources and rely almost totally on the public to fund our work.
